Weight Lifting and Pelvic Pressure: What You Need to Know

Staying active and lifting weights in your 40s, 50s, and beyond is one of the best things you can do for your testosterone levels and cardiovascular health. However, many men notice that heavy leg days (like squats and deadlifts) trigger an annoying flare-up of urinary urgency and pelvic aching later that evening.

Understanding how heavy lifting impacts a swollen prostate is vital for maintaining your gym routine without sacrificing your comfort.

The Danger of Intra-Abdominal Pressure

When you brace your core to lift a heavy weight (the Valsalva maneuver), you create massive intra-abdominal pressure. This pressure acts like a piston, pushing all of your internal organs forcefully downward against your pelvic floor and prostate gland.

If your prostate is already swollen and inflamed, this crushing downward force causes:

  • Micro-traumas to the delicate blood vessels surrounding the prostate.
  • Severe exhaustion of the pelvic floor muscles, leading to post-workout leaking or dribbling.
  • A dramatic increase in nighttime urgency due to the localized trauma sustained during the workout.

Train Smarter, Not Softer

You do not need to quit lifting, but you must prioritize breathing smoothly through reps (never holding your breath entirely) and providing your body with top-tier internal recovery tools.
